Re: Highlights Of Buhari’s Meeting With Putin At The Russia-african Summit by VEE2010(m): 4:55pm On Oct 24, 2019
Normally, bilateral meetings are supposed to establish mutually beneficial relations between nations.
The write-up seems incomplete because the journalist did not mention the benefits that Russia might derive from the discussion during the meeting or does he try to misinform the population for political reasons?
No nation is immune to challenge that needs international collaboration. Bilateral meeting is a win-win situation and, in most cases, the western world benefits more because they seem to be hiding their exploitative tendencies under the guise of helping or supporting the Third World countries.
Nigeria has entered into countless bilateral agreement and sometimes the government will colour it to look as if, such will end the suffering of a common man the next day but all turned out to disappointments.
Let's always have a balance reportage on bilateral talks as to understand what we stand to lose while we gain some...
My candid opinion though
